日期:2014-05-16 浏览次数:20408 次
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>Test</title> </head> 日期:<input type="text" class="input2" name="date1" id="startTime" readonly="readonly" onClick="this.value='';fPopCalendar(this,this,this.value);return false;"/><font color="#CCCCCC">点击输入框选择日期</font> <script> function getNowDate() { var nn=new Date(); year1=nn.getYear(); mon1=nn.getMonth()+1; date1=nn.getDate(); var monstr1; var datestr1 if(mon1<10) monstr1="0"+mon1; else monstr1=""+mon1; if(date1<10) datestr1="0"+date1; else datestr1=""+date1; return year1+"-"+monstr1+"-"+datestr1; } //last date function getlastweekDate() { var nn=new Date(); year1=nn.getYear(); mon1=nn.getMonth()+1; date1=nn.getDate(); var mm=new Date(year1,mon1-1,date1); var tmp1=new Date(2000,1,1); var tmp2=new Date(2000,1,15); var ne=tmp2-tmp1; var mm2=new Date(); mm2.setTime(mm.getTime()-ne); year2=mm2.getYear(); mon2=mm2.getMonth()+1; date2=mm2.getDate(); if(mon2<10) monstr2="0"+mon2; else monstr2=""+mon2; if(date2<10) datestr2="0"+date2; else datestr2=""+date2; return year2+"-"+monstr2+"-"+datestr2; } var gdCtrl = new Object(); var goSelectTag = new Array(); var gcGray = "#808080"; var gcToggle = "#FB8664"; var gcBG = "#e5e6ec"; var previousObject = null; var gdCurDate = new Date(); var giYear = gdCurDate.getFullYear(); var giMonth = gdCurDate.getMonth()+1; var giDay = gdCurDate.getDate(); function fSetDate(iYear, iMonth, iDay){ var VicPopCal = document.getElementById('VicPopCal'); VicPopCal.style.visibility = "hidden"; if ((iYear == 0) && (iMonth == 0) && (iDay == 0)){ gdCtrl.value = ""; }else{ iMonth = iMonth + 100 + ""; iMonth = iMonth.substring(1); iDay = iDay + 100 + ""; iDay = iDay.substring(1); if(gdCtrl.tagName == "INPUT"){ gdCtrl.value = iYear+"-"+iMonth+"-"+iDay; }else{ gdCtrl.innerText = iYear+"-"+iMonth+"-"+iDay; } } for (i in goSelectTag) goSelectTag[i].style.visibility = "visible"; goSelectTag.length = 0; window.returnValue=gdCtrl.value; //window.close(); } function HiddenDiv() { var VicPopCal = document.getElementById('VicPopCal'); var i; VicPopCal.style.visibility = "hidden"; for (i in goSelectTag) goSelectTag[i].style.visibility = "visible"; goSelectTag.length = 0; } function fSetSelected(aCell){ var tbSelMonth1 = document.getElementById('tbSelMonth'); var tbSelYear1 = document.getElementById('tbSelYear'); var iOffset = 0; var iYear = parseInt(tbSelYear1.value); var iMonth = parseInt(tbSelMonth1.value); aCell.bgColor = gcBG; // with (aCell.children["cellText"]){ with (aCell.childNodes[0]){ var iDay = parseInt(innerHTML); if (color==gcGray) iOffset = (Victor<10)?-1:1; iMonth += iOffset; if (iMonth<1) { iYear--; iMonth = 12; }else if (iMonth>12){ iYear++; iMonth = 1; } } fSetDate(iYear, iMonth, iDay); } function Point(iX, iY){ this.x = iX;